If I _were_ twenty years younger," he went on, addressing himself to Geoffrey, "and if I _did_ step out on the lawn with you, the result wouldn't affect the question between us in the least.

I don't say that the violent bodily exercises in which you are famous have damaged your muscular power.

I assert that they have damaged your vital power.

In what particular way they have affected it I don't consider myself bound to tell you.

I simply give you a warning, as a matter of common humanity.
